Introduction
Decentralized cryptocurrency wallets have long faced criticism for one critical flaw: if you lose your seed phrase, your assets are gone forever. This remains a major barrier for crypto newcomers. According to Chainalysis research, by 2021, 20% of circulating Bitcoin had been permanently lost due to forgotten private keys.
Traditionally, avoiding centralized custody meant users had to self-manage private keys. However, innovative solutions like the OKX MPC Wallet are changing the game—eliminating the need for manual private key recording while maintaining true decentralization.
What Is the OKX MPC Wallet?
OKX MPC Wallet (Multi-Party Computation Wallet), also called a "keyless wallet," represents a breakthrough in wallet technology. Unlike traditional systems, it uses secure cryptography to split a wallet's private key into multiple fragments stored across different locations. These fragments only combine during transaction signing, allowing seamless wallet recovery even if users forget their keys.
How It Works:
During creation, the wallet divides the seed phrase into three encrypted fragments:
- Fragment 1: Stored on OKX servers
- Fragment 2: Saved on the user’s mobile device
- Fragment 3: Encrypted and backed up to iCloud/Google Drive
- Transactions require any two fragments for authorization, balancing security with accessibility.
OKX MPC Wallet vs. Multisig Wallets
| Feature | OKX MPC Wallet | Multisig Wallet |
|---|---|---|
| Key Structure | Single private key split into fragments | Multiple independent private keys |
| Signing Process | Combines fragments to reconstruct key | Requires separate signatures from keys |
| Recovery | Easier with fragment redundancy | Dependent on key holders |
Key Difference: MPC wallets enhance usability without compromising security—no need to manage multiple keys while maintaining robust protection.
Advantages of OKX MPC Wallet
✅ Decentralized Asset Storage
OKX holds only one fragment, ensuring true non-custodial control. Users retain ownership, unlike centralized exchanges.
✅ Streamlined Transactions
Combining fragments (e.g., OKX’s + mobile device) mimics the convenience of hot wallets.
✅ Effortless Seed Recovery
Losing your phone? Use OKX’s fragment and your cloud backup to restore access—no irreversible losses.
✅ Enhanced Private Key Security
Even if OKX becomes inaccessible, fragments from your device and cloud can reconstruct the private key without third-party approval.
✅ Hack Resistance
With keys split across locations, hackers gaining one fragment cannot access funds, unlike traditional hot wallets.
Limitations to Consider
❌ Cloud Backup Risks
Compromised iCloud/Google credentials could expose fragments. Users must:
- Use strong, unique passwords
- Enable two-factor authentication
- Regularly update backups
❌ No Direct Seed Phrase Access
While fragmentation boosts security, some users may prefer full private key control.
❌ Mobile-Only Creation
Currently limited to smartphones, though accessible via OKX’s web platform via QR login.

FAQ
Q1: Is the OKX MPC Wallet truly non-custodial?
Yes. OKX cannot access funds without your combined fragments, ensuring decentralized control.
Q2: What happens if I lose my phone and cloud backup?
Without two fragments, recovery becomes impossible. Always maintain multiple backups.
Q3: Can I migrate my existing wallet to OKX MPC?
Not directly. You’ll need to transfer assets to a newly created MPC wallet.
Q4: How does MPC compare to hardware wallets?
MPC offers similar security with greater convenience but relies on digital fragment storage.
Q5: Are there transaction fees for using MPC?
Standard blockchain gas fees apply; OKX does not charge additional costs.
